  • Fiber composite material, use therefor, and method for the production thereof
    申请人:Covestro Deutschland AG
    公开号:US10808086B2
    公开(公告)日:2020-10-20
    The invention relates to a fibre composite (42) comprising at least one fibre layer (4, 14, 16) composed of a fibre material which is embedded in a matrix (8, 18) based on a thermoplastic, where the composition of the matrix (8, 18) contains: 60-95 parts by weight of aromatic polycarbonate and/or aromatic polyester carbonate and further additives. The invention further relates to the use of such a fibre composite for a component for a rail vehicle, in particular for a rail vehicle for transporting passengers. The invention further relates to a process for producing a fibre composite, in which a layer structure (36) of superposed layers is formed from at least one fibre layer (4, 14, 16) composed of a fibre material and from polymer layers which are composed of at least one polymer film (30) and are arranged on both sides of the fibre layer (4, 14, 16) and in which the layer structure (36) is pressed under applied pressure and the action of heat to form a fibre composite (42), where the polymer film (30) has a composition corresponding to the matrix of the abovementioned fibre composite.
